Output 784898555e8b2d9f53be2fa7ef2fc9c4f0070f4622885561c10a7c78d5882da5:1

value
26066676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57daa8296a861d2cf8c8dea07b5d31ce07a5d6ae OP_EQUAL
address
MFugxfaTpgsLYkH17vnNDaBenY9XdFG9qi
transaction
784898555e8b2d9f53be2fa7ef2fc9c4f0070f4622885561c10a7c78d5882da5
spent
true